Albuquerque, NM (February 10, 2026) – Emergency crews responded Tuesday morning to a reported traffic accident with injuries at the intersection of Lynn Ave NE and California St NE in Albuquerque. Fire and rescue units arrived to assess those involved and provide medical care while working to secure the intersection. Responders focused on patient checks and scene safety as traffic moved cautiously through the area.

Local Context
Lynn Ave NE and California St NE are neighborhood streets where short sightlines, parked vehicles, and frequent turning movements can create sudden conflicts. When an injury accident is reported in Albuquerque, responders typically focus first on medical evaluations while creating a protected work area within the intersection. Traffic is often slowed or briefly redirected so paramedics can move safely between vehicles and check for hazards like debris or fluid on the roadway. Even after initial care is provided, drivers in the area may experience short delays while vehicle positions are documented and the intersection is cleared.
